A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Name für Dateien

Ein Thema von DarthBane · begonnen am 11. Mär 2010 · letzter Beitrag vom 11. Mär 2010
Antwort Antwort
DarthBane

Registriert seit: 11. Mär 2010
2 Beiträge
 
#1

Name für Dateien

  Alt 11. Mär 2010, 20:15
Hallo,

in letzter Zeit habe ich des öfteren Probleme beim Abspeichern des Quellcodes und der Projektdateien.
Da bei mir die Hilfe nicht funktioniert konnte ich auch nicht Nachschauen, was sich hinter der Meldung "'...' ist kein Gültiger Bezeichner" genau verbirgt bzw. was an den Namen angekreidet wird.
Was gibt es für Regel bezüglich der Namensgebung von Dateien (und Projekten).
Welche Zeichen sind nicht erlaubt und wie lang/kurz dürfen/müssen Dateinamen sein?

DarthBane
  Mit Zitat antworten Zitat
Benutzerbild von DeddyH
DeddyH

Registriert seit: 17. Sep 2006
Ort: Barchfeld
27.625 Beiträge
 
Delphi 12 Athens
 
#2

Re: Name für Dateien

  Alt 11. Mär 2010, 20:21
Zitat von DarthBane:
Da bei mir die Hilfe nicht funktioniert ...
Diesen Umstand solltest Du als Erstes beheben. Ich kenne zwar jetzt nicht alle Konventionen für gültige Dateinamen, aber zumindest dürfen diese keine Umlaute oder Leerzeichen enthalten.
Detlef
"Ich habe Angst vor dem Tag, an dem die Technologie unsere menschlichen Interaktionen übertrumpft. Die Welt wird eine Generation von Idioten bekommen." (Albert Einstein)
Dieser Tag ist längst gekommen
  Mit Zitat antworten Zitat
Benutzerbild von Wolfgang Mix
Wolfgang Mix

Registriert seit: 13. Mai 2009
Ort: Lübeck
1.222 Beiträge
 
Delphi 2005 Personal
 
#3

Re: Name für Dateien

  Alt 11. Mär 2010, 20:24
Herzlich willkommen in der DP.
Schaue 'mal hier
Wolfgang Mix
if you can't explain it simply you don't understand it well enough - A. Einstein
Mein Baby:http://www.epubli.de/shop/buch/Grund...41818516/52824
  Mit Zitat antworten Zitat
Benutzerbild von DeddyH
DeddyH

Registriert seit: 17. Sep 2006
Ort: Barchfeld
27.625 Beiträge
 
Delphi 12 Athens
 
#4

Re: Name für Dateien

  Alt 11. Mär 2010, 20:27
Ich habe diesen Fehler gerade einmal provoziert und mir die Hilfe anzeigen lassen:
Zitat:
<IDname> ist kein gültiger Bezeichner
Der Name des Bezeichners ist ungültig. Achten Sie darauf, dass das erste Zeichen ein Buchstabe oder ein Unterstrich (_) ist. Die nachfolgenden Zeichen können Buchstaben, Ziffern oder Unterstrich-Zeichen sein. Es dürfen sich außerdem keine Leerzeichen innerhalb des Bezeichners befinden.
Detlef
"Ich habe Angst vor dem Tag, an dem die Technologie unsere menschlichen Interaktionen übertrumpft. Die Welt wird eine Generation von Idioten bekommen." (Albert Einstein)
Dieser Tag ist längst gekommen
  Mit Zitat antworten Zitat
DarthBane

Registriert seit: 11. Mär 2010
2 Beiträge
 
#5

Re: Name für Dateien

  Alt 11. Mär 2010, 20:35
Ich hab's jetzt nochmal ausprobiert und es hat geklappt:
Nur Buchstaben und Unterstriche.
Und ich hab' gemerkt, dass der Name durchaus sehr lang sein kann.

Danke für die schnelle Hilfe!
Frieden ist eine Lüge. Es gibt nur Leidenschaft.
Durch Leidenschaft erlange ich Kraft. Durch Kraft erlange ich Macht. Durch Macht erlange ich den Sieg. Der Sieg zerbricht meine Ketten.
Darth Bane - Schöpfer der Dunkelheit
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.184 Beiträge
 
Delphi 12 Athens
 
#6

Re: Name für Dateien

  Alt 11. Mär 2010, 21:00
Zitat von DeddyH:
Ich habe diesen Fehler gerade einmal provoziert und mir die Hilfe anzeigen lassen:
...
Also praktisch wie überall die selben Regeln für einen gültigen Bezeichner.
> Variablen, Funktionsnamen, Typenbezeichnungen und eben auch Unitnamen, sowie jegliche andere als "Namespace" nutzbare Bezeichnung.

Außer daß bei Dateinamen neuerdings auch Punkte erlaubt sind, was aber oftmals keine Probleme bereitet, da die Unit ja am Anfang des er Namespacehierarchie liegt.
Wobei als Buchstaben alles gültig ist, was laut Unicode die Kennung "alpha" besitzt.
$2B or not $2B
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 15:04 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z